# How to update Security Groups for EC2-VPC instances
|
410
|
+
The behavior of the `machine` resource is that once a machine has been allocated,
|
411
|
+
the `bootstrap_options` can not be modified. This currently reflects AWS's
|
412
|
+
restrictions on EC2-Classic instances, but AWS *does* allow users to modify the
|
413
|
+
security groups associated with EC2-VPC instances. This is because the security
|
414
|
+
groups for EC2-VPC instances are _actually_ associated with that instance's
|
415
|
+
Network Interface. This means that if you wish to modify the security groups
|
416
|
+
associated with an EC2-VPC instance, you'll want to use the `aws_network_interface`
|
417
|
+
resource.
|
418
|
+
|
419
|
+
The first step is to find the Network Interface ID (`eni-XXXXXXX`) associated
|
420
|
+
with your machine. You can do this by inspecting the instance details in the AWS
|
421
|
+
Console or by using the AWS CLI. If you want to use the AWS CLI, you can use
|
422
|
+
this command replacing `MACHINE_NAME` with the name of the `machine` resource
|
423
|
+
you wish to update.
|
424
|
+
|
425
|
+
```shell
|
426
|
+
aws ec2 describe-instances --filter "Name=tag:Name,Values=MACHINE_NAME" | grep NetworkInterfaceId
|
427
|
+
```
|
428
|
+
|
429
|
+
Once you have the Network Interface ID, in a chef-provisioning recipe you can
|
430
|
+
specify the following resource:
|
431
|
+
|
432
|
+
```ruby
|
433
|
+
require 'chef/provisioning/aws_driver'
|
434
|
+
with_driver 'aws' # specify the profile / region as appropriate
|
435
|
+
|
436
|
+
aws_network_interface 'eni-XXXXXXXX' do
|
437
|
+
security_groups ['sg-XXXXXXXX', 'sg-YYYYYYYY']
|
438
|
+
end
|
439
|
+
```
|
440
|
+
|
441
|
+
This resource can be in the same chef-provisioning recipe as the corresponding
|
442
|
+
machine resource, or it can be in a different one.
